package web
import (
"net/http"
"antidrift/internal/settings"
"github.com/gin-gonic/gin"
)
// SetSettings injects the persisted settings, their file path, and the applier
// closure (built by main, which owns adapter construction). Mirrors the
// controller's Set* injection so web never imports ai/tasks/knowledge.
func (s *Server) SetSettings(path string, current settings.Settings, apply func(settings.Settings) error) {
s.settingsMu.Lock()
s.settingsPath = path
s.settings = current
s.applyFn = apply
s.settingsMu.Unlock()
}
func (s *Server) handleGetSettings(c *gin.Context) {
s.settingsMu.Lock()
cur := s.settings
s.settingsMu.Unlock()
c.JSON(http.StatusOK, cur)
}
// handlePostSettings validates-and-applies atomically, then persists. The applier
// checks the backend before mutating any state, so an invalid backend yields 400
// with nothing saved and the prior wiring intact.
func (s *Server) handlePostSettings(c *gin.Context) {
var req settings.Settings
if err := c.ShouldBindJSON(&req); err != nil {
c.JSON(http.StatusBadRequest, gin.H{"error": "invalid json"})
return
}
s.settingsMu.Lock()
apply := s.applyFn
path := s.settingsPath
s.settingsMu.Unlock()
if apply == nil {
c.JSON(http.StatusInternalServerError, gin.H{"error": "settings not wired"})
return
}
if err := apply(req); err != nil {
// Apply validates the backend before mutating anything, so any error
// (invalid backend or otherwise) means nothing changed; surface it as 400.
c.JSON(http.StatusBadRequest, gin.H{"error": err.Error()})
return
}
if err := settings.Save(path, req); err != nil {
c.JSON(http.StatusInternalServerError, gin.H{"error": err.Error()})
return
}
s.settingsMu.Lock()
s.settings = req
s.settingsMu.Unlock()
s.broadcast()
c.JSON(http.StatusOK, req)
}

package web
import (
"encoding/json"
"net/http"
"net/http/httptest"
"os"
"path/filepath"
"testing"
"antidrift/internal/settings"
)
// fakeApplier records the last settings it was asked to apply and can be told to
// reject with ErrInvalidBackend.
type fakeApplier struct {
called int
last settings.Settings
reject bool
}
func (f *fakeApplier) apply(s settings.Settings) error {
if f.reject {
return settings.ErrInvalidBackend
}
f.called++
f.last = s
return nil
}
func TestGetSettingsReturnsCurrent(t *testing.T) {
s := newTestServer(t)
cur := settings.Settings{AIBackend: "claude", MarvinCmd: "am", KnowledgePath: "/tmp/k.md"}
fa := &fakeApplier{}
s.SetSettings(filepath.Join(t.TempDir(), "settings.json"), cur, fa.apply)
r := s.Router()
req := httptest.NewRequest(http.MethodGet, "/settings", nil)
w := httptest.NewRecorder()
r.ServeHTTP(w, req)
if w.Code != http.StatusOK {
t.Fatalf("status = %d, want 200", w.Code)
}
var got settings.Settings
if err := json.Unmarshal(w.Body.Bytes(), &got);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("decode: %v", err)
}
if got != cur {
t.Errorf("got %+v, want %+v", got, cur)
}
}
func TestPostSettingsValidAppliesAndSaves(t *testing.T) {
s := newTestServer(t)
path := filepath.Join(t.TempDir(), "settings.json")
fa := &fakeApplier{}
s.SetSettings(path, settings.Settings{}, fa.apply)
r := s.Router()
body := `{"ai_backend":"codex","marvin_cmd":"uv run am","knowledge_path":"/tmp/k.md"}`
w := post(t, r, "/settings", body)
if w.Code != http.StatusOK {
t.Fatalf("status = %d, want 200 (body %s)", w.Code, w.Body.String())
}
if fa.called != 1 {
t.Fatalf("applier called %d times, want 1", fa.called)
}
if fa.last.AIBackend != "codex" {
t.Errorf("applied backend = %q, want codex", fa.last.AIBackend)
}
if _, err := os.Stat(path); err != nil {
t.Errorf("settings file not written: %v", err)
}
}
func TestPostSettingsInvalidBackendIs400AndNoSave(t *testing.T) {
s := newTestServer(t)
path := filepath.Join(t.TempDir(), "settings.json")
fa := &fakeApplier{reject: true}
s.SetSettings(path, settings.Settings{}, fa.apply)
r := s.Router()
w := post(t, r, "/settings", `{"ai_backend":"bogus"}`)
if w.Code != http.StatusBadRequest {
t.Fatalf("status = %d, want 400", w.Code)
}
if _, err := os.Stat(path); !os.IsNotExist(err) {
t.Errorf("settings file should not exist after rejected save, stat err = %v", err)
}
}
